Volume of manuscript notes on religious subjects, 1691, with later related inserted items, 1817

Manuscript volume containing devotional exercises and describing liturgical forms, possibly preparatory notes for divine service, compiled by Richard Woodroffe of London. Including commentary on the Eucharist, thanksgiving, and the value of prayer, 1691. With insert containing extracts from Monthly review, April 1813, and European magazine, April 1813, mainly concerning the episcopate, and on George Wither, poet, from Monthly magazine, October, 1817. 1691, 1817. 1 volume with loose inserts

Volume of manuscript extracts from the Bible, [1350-1400]

Manuscript volume of biblical extracts including verses of the Epistle of St Paul, the apostles Peter and John and the apocrypha, mid to late 14th century. Bound with name 'Richard Triplett, 1724' inscribed on cover. Manuscript insert by Leathes including extract from the Vulgate, presented to him by The British and Foreign Bible Society, via the Reverend John Owen, 1813, [1350-1400]. 1 volume

Volume of manuscript copy extracts from ancient and contemporary sources, [1800-1838]

Manuscript volume entitled 'Collectanea ad historiam ingenii human spectantia', a collection of excerpts and commonplaces derived from a large variety of ancient and modern reference sources including the writings of Tacitus and Charles de Secondat, Baron de la Brède et de Montesquieu, covering topics as diverse as the kings of England, the history of medieval Germany, Spanish drama and modern developments in agriculture. 1 volume

Volume of lectures by physician George Fordyce on chronic diseases, 1786, taken by Daniel Jarvis

Lectures on chronic diseases by George Fordyce MD FRS, Censor of the Royal College of Physicians, Readers of the Practice of Physic in London, and Senior Physician to St Thomas's Hospital, taken by Daniel Jarvis, 1786'.Manuscript volumes of 53 lectures, Volume 1, folios 1-186, containing index to all three volumes; Volume 2, folios 189-380; Volume 3, folios 381-585.

Volume of certificates and testimonials, 1851-1878, for William Blackett

Volume titled 'Blackett's certificates 1853' containing sixteen certificates of St Thomas's Hospital Medical School confirming Blackett's attendance and proficiency in various subjects 1851-1853; examination certificate of the Society of Apothecaries, May 1853; Royal College of Surgeons certificate Apr 1853; receipt from the Council of Medical Education and Registration for £2; printed copy of the testimonials for Blackett 1853-1878.

Volume of case notes, 1828-1830, for surgical cases at St Thomas's and Guy's Hospitals compiled by Frederick Le Gros Clark

Papers of Frederick Le Gros Clark, comprising volume of surgical cases at St Thomas's and Guy's Hospitals, 1828-1830, compiled by Clark for a prize, containing cases under Joseph Henry Green, Benjamin Travers, Frederick Tyrell, Charles Aston Key, Bransby Blake Cooper and John Morgan.

Visual works by Lawrence Upton, 1989-1994

Lawrence Upton, visual material: two A4 visuals, titled 'Vortex?' and 'Field', 1977; six printed visual poem cards of assorted colour; text leaflets for 40th and 45th birthdays, and unspecified birthday leaflet featuring Shelley; text card 'Walking on the lizard' (Form Books, London, 1994); four cards with hand and computer designs; set of Upton 'Poster Campaign' sheets, 1992, with spares of many items

Visual works and photographs relating to Nuttall, with publicity leaflets and press cuttings, 1966-1992

Jeff Nuttall, visuals, photographs and promotional material: hand-drawn card for Mottram's 65th birthday, 1989; black and white photographs of Nuttall, including one with Bob Cobbing and Mottram, one of house in Todmorden, Lancashire, and one of a brass band, 6 items; five colour photographs of Nuttall sculptures/paintings, 1992; folder with details of exhibition at I. C. A. (Institute of Contemporary Arts, London) by students of Leeds Polytechnic Fine Art Department; printed sheets with details of Nuttall publication, career and exhibitions; newspaper article headed 'Jeff Nuttall's prolific anarchic word-painting' from Yorkshire Post 7 Apr 1978; newspaper articles on Nuttall and reviews of his work, 1966-1990, including 'Underground changes' from Village Voice 19 May 1966, mentioning My Own Mag, and review of exhibition at Halifax in 1990 by Robert Clark; photocopy of newspaper article on Nuttall by Anne Pickles, headed 'Looking back in anger' from Yorkshire Evening Poets 10 Sep 1990 (outsize); invitations to and leaflets of Nuttall events and exhibitions, including a retrospective at Dean Clough Contemporary Art Gallery, Halifax, Sep 1990, an exhibition of landscape paintings at the Angela Flowers Gallery, London, 1987, and a promotional leaflet for 'Jack', performance group based on Nuttall and Rose Maguire
